Coconut Rolls

Prep: 20 min Cook: 15 min

Sweet and coconut-flavored rolls with a buttery, caramelized topping, perfect for breakfast or dessert, appealing to those who love rich, flaky baked treats.

Be the first to rate this recipe

Ingredients

  • roll dough
  • butter or margarine
  • brown sugar
  • flaked coconut

Instructions

  1. Roll out the dough to about 1/2-inch thickness.
  2. Warm butter or margarine in the bottom of a baking pan.
  3. Spread some of the melted butter or margarine on the dough.
  4. Follow with brown sugar, then coconut flakes.
  5. Roll up the dough tightly.
  6. Cut into 3/4-inch slices.
  7. Dip each slice in the melted butter or margarine in the pan, then turn so it has a buttered top.
  8. Raise to a desired height in the pan and cook until golden brown and cooked through.

Tips & Substitutions

To enhance flavor, consider adding a pinch of cinnamon or nutmeg to the brown sugar mixture. For a dairy-free option, use coconut oil instead of butter or margarine. If you prefer a different texture, try using sweetened coconut flakes for added sweetness. Ensure your dough is not too sticky; if it is, lightly flour your work surface as you roll it out.

Storage & Reheating

Store leftover coconut rolls in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. For longer storage, refrigerate them for up to a week. To reheat, place them in a preheated oven at 350°F for about 10 minutes, or until warmed through, restoring some of the original texture.
